Dental care can be one of the most vital needs in health care, however, if it is affordable, your needs can be met. Once you give up dental care, you may get more severe medical conditions.

In addition to the likelihood of losing your teeth, it can also affect your heart, brain, and immune system.

Based on the American Dental Association (ADA), a gum disease that triggers tooth loss (known as periodontitis) is related to other more serious conditions, such as bacterial pneumonia, stroke, and cardiovascular disease. Other studies indicate that an unhealthy mouth can be associated with diabetes.

Without the proper dental hygiene, small cavities or painful teeth can result in more severe complications than tooth decay. You should not delay making a consultation.

Stay away from frequent X-rays: Your dentist may advise a dental x-ray on your initial appointment, a scheduled check-up, or a return for treatment.

But the American Dental Association (ADA) advises that the regularity of trips to the dentist’s X-ray chair be based upon the present state of the patient’s dental health.

Therefore, if you have good oral health, you just don’t need dental x-rays at every visit to the dental professional.

By taking an X-ray with your teeth less often, you can’t only save lots of money, however it will also prevent you from being in contact with possibly damaging X-rays.

Seeking Dentistry at a School of Dentistry: To increase the size of your dental savings, consider getting your dental care at a dental school, where dental procedures will be performed by students under the supervision of qualified dentists at a portion of what you would spend in the medical clinic of a private dentist.

Floss and brush

Clean and healthy teeth are the start of dental health. Routine use of dental floss and brushing is critical to keep your gums and teeth healthy and healthy. Brush teeth twice a day with a fluoride toothpaste that helps prevent cavities.

Don’t be in a rush. Instead, spend some time to brush teeth. Don’t forget to use a toothbrush that matches the structure of your mouth and the position of your teeth.

Your toothbrush must be soft and well rounded. Also, clean the tongue in order to avoid foul breath and make sure to change your toothbrush every two months.

Daily dental flossing is important. Flossing can help you reach the firm spaces between your teeth and below the gum line. Rub the sides of your teeth gently with floss and don’t skimp.

In case you have trouble flossing between your teeth, use waxed dental floss. Be as cautious as possible when flossing in order to avoid hurting your gums. Furthermore, consider providing dental prostheses as real teeth in your dental habits.

Watch your diet

Refrain from sugary food products because too much-refined sugar boosts the growth of the plaque. Ensure you drink and take healthy foods, like low-fat dairy products, whole wheat, and green vegetables.

Drink plenty of water to stay hydrated. Avoid fizzy drinks such as soda and caffeine, as they can dehydrate you and damage teeth.

Do not use cigarettes and tobacco products as they trigger gum disease and oral cancer. It should be taken into account that eating healthy should be part of your daily routine and is as necessary as flossing and brushing your teeth.
